The Zhaozhou Bridge is celebrated as China's oldest standing bridge and the oldest open spandrel stone bridge in the world.[6]. The two pairs of segmental arches in the spandrels not only served to reduce the load of the masonry on the haunches of the arch but also provided an overflow for floodwater. Credited to the design of a craftsman named Li Chun(), the bridge was constructed in the years 595-605 during the Sui Dynasty (581-618). As apparently recognized by Joseph Needham, any great work of engineering and architecture owes its existence and appearance to the evolution and performance of successful progenitors And evidence of some of these An Ji Bridge progenitors have been found by Huan Chang Tang, the co-author of this paper In his book on the History of Chinese Science and TechnologyBridges (2), Tang provides photographs of a number of stone panel carvings from the Han Dynasty (202 B C to 220 A.D.) depicting the use of short-span segmental arches being used as roadway bridges for small stream and canal crossings (Figure 3 1) However, unlike the An Ji Bridge, which has a shallow rise of only 19 percent of the span length and a relatively straight roadway, these early segmental bridges had little or no approach embankments, arch rises of nearly 25 percent of their span lengths, and roadways that paralleled arch curvatures Consequently, to negotiate such high rise segmental arch bridges, special practices had to be devised to help horse-drawn carriages cross over the hump of such bridges And the carved panels from the Han Dynasty illustrate how this was done, Some of these carved panels show a group of three laborers stationed at each end of arch type bridges It appears that the laborers are handling ropes attached to horse-drawn carriages crossing the bridges Those at the forward end of a bridge help the horses by pulling its carriage to the bridge's apex, while those at the rear are waiting to slow a carriage's descent by pulling on it from behind Some of the panels depict arch bridges with intermediate supports while other panels show arch bridges without such supports So it is clear that some of these panels are depicting single-span segmental arch bridges Since many carriages with multiple horse teams are also depicted on these panels, and groups of laborers with ropes are shown stationed at each end of each of these bridges, it appears clear that in Ancient China methods had been developed to expedite the movement of vehicular traffic across waterways on segmental arch bridges before the beginning of the last millennium. In his monumental study of Science and Civilization in China, Joseph Needham stated, [T]he first great segmental arch bridge was constructed by Li [Chun] in China after +600, but no such structures were built elsewhere until Italy followed with several of the kind shortly after +1300, and the design has flourished since .
